Question : Find the value of p, when p = (5 ÷ 6) of 54 – 40 ÷ 10 – 41 – 22
Option 1: –11
Option 2: –22
Option 3: –18
Option 4: –23
Correct Answer: –22
Solution : p = (5 ÷ 6) of 54 – 40 ÷ 10 – 41 – 22 = $\frac{5}{6}$ × 54 – 4 – 41 – 22 = 45 – 4 – 41 – 22 = – 22 Hence, the correct answer is – 22.

Question : When was the Indian Forest Service set up?
Option 1: July 1, 1966
Option 2: July 1, 1968
Option 3: July 1, 1967
Option 4: July 1, 1965
Correct Answer: July 1, 1966
Solution : The correct answer is July 1, 1966.

Question : Directions: After interchanging the given two signs, what will be the value of the given equation? × and + 24 × 8 + 6 ÷ 3 – 18 = ?
Option 1: 24
Option 2: 23
Option 3: 22
Option 4: 20
Correct Answer: 22
Solution : Given: × and + 24 × 8 + 6 ÷ 3 – 18
After interchanging the mathematical signs, the equation becomes – = 24 + 8 × 6 ÷ 3 – 18 = 24 + 16 – 18 = 40 – 18 = 22

Question : In the following question, out of the given four alternatives, select the alternative which best expresses the meaning of the Idiom/Phrase. Hard/tough nut to crack
Option 1: To understand clearly
Option 2: Not being able to enjoy oneself
Option 3: A difficult person, problem or situation
Option 4: Good for nothing
Correct Answer: A difficult person, problem or situation
The idiom hard or tough nut to crack refers to a challenging or difficult person, problem, or situation.
Hence, the correct answer is, a difficult person, problem, or situation.
